Capital Planning Specialist

London, ENG, GB, United Kingdom

Job Description

Let us tell you a bit about the opportunity




Following an internal move we have an opportunity for a Capital Planning Specialist to join our Group-wide capital planning team which sits within our broader Treasury function. You'll be responsible for production of monthly capital management information, owning key elements of the budgeting and forecasting process (incl. stress testing), support with the annual ICAAP, and support with policy & requirements.


As a member of the Capital Planning and wider Treasury team, you'll act as a first line of defence for Capital Risk, helping to ensure that Aldermore Group remains adequately capitalised to support the Group's strategy under both steady state and stressed conditions.

What will your day look like?



You'll report into the Head of Capital Planning who will be your line manager and responsible for things like performance review meetings, one-to-ones and development conversations Production of monthly and ad hoc capital management information, including liaising with the Regulatory Reporting team Support with the budgeting/forecasting process, including the opportunity to enhance modelling, processes and forward-looking MI Support with co-ordination and analysis for the annual ICAAP Help with interpreting and implementing any relevant regulatory change Support with elements of the Group's capital strategy/optimisation initiatives, including capital issuance, rating agency relationships, and any relevant regulatory permissions

What do we expect from you?



Excellent communication and interpersonal skills, ability to build relationships with key stakeholders and articulate technical concepts in a clear and succinct way Highly numerate with an ability to analyse financial data, with an eye for detail and aptitude for problem solving In-depth knowledge of MS Office packages, Excel in particular Confident, articulate, and able to challenge the status-quo Previous modelling experience within a finance or treasury role, experience of Capital Management is desirable An understanding of retail / commercial banking is desirable
